+/// TODO: This is copied from clang diagnostics. Maybe we could just move it to
+/// some common place. (Same as HandleOrdinalModifier.)
+void StackHintGeneratorForSymbol::printOrdinal(unsigned ValNo,
+ llvm::raw_svector_ostream &Out) {
+ assert(ValNo != 0 && "ValNo must be strictly positive!");
+
+ // We could use text forms for the first N ordinals, but the numeric
+ // forms are actually nicer in diagnostics because they stand out.
+ Out << ValNo;
+
+ // It is critically important that we do this perfectly for
+ // user-written sequences with over 100 elements.
+ switch (ValNo % 100) {
+ case 11:
+ case 12:
+ case 13:
+ Out << "th"; return;
+ default:
+ switch (ValNo % 10) {
+ case 1: Out << "st"; return;
+ case 2: Out << "nd"; return;
+ case 3: Out << "rd"; return;
+ default: Out << "th"; return;
+ }
+ }
+}
